This XpressRead Cram Edition of Emmanuel Appadocca pairs the complete original text with carefully prepared study materials, designed for deeper engagement with this classic.

Journey to the tumultuous Caribbean seas with Maxwell Philip's compelling work of historical fiction, Emmanuel Appadocca; or, blighted life, Volume 2 of 2, a captivating tale of the boucaneers. This enduring narrative plunges readers into a world of daring sea adventure, where buccaneers navigate treacherous waters and the stakes of survival are ever-present.

Set against the vivid backdrop of Trinidad and the broader Caribbean, Emmanuel Appadocca is more than just an adventure story; it is a profound exploration of an era defined by struggle and transformation. Philip meticulously weaves together thrilling escapades with the stark realities of slavery, offering an unflinching look at its devastating reach. Central to the story are the intricate dynamics of father-son relationships, adding a deeply personal and emotional dimension to the grand scope of historical events. This powerful volume delivers a rich tapestry of human experience, from the high drama of naval exploits to the intimate conflicts that shape character. It is a testament to the enduring power of stories that combine action, moral reflection, and unforgettable settings, inviting readers to immerse themselves in a significant chapter of history and human endeavor.
